C语言再学习:单精度(float)和双精度(double)浮点数与十六进制(HEX)之间转换
简介
本资源文件提供了关于C语言中单精度(float)和双精度(double)浮点数与十六进制(HEX)之间转换的详细教程。通过学习本教程,您将掌握如何在C语言中实现这两种数据类型之间的转换,这对于嵌入式开发和网络通信中的数据处理非常有用。
内容概述
- 浮点数介绍:
- 单精度浮点数(float):精确到小数点后6位。
- 双精度浮点数(double):精确到小数点后12位。
- 浮点数与十六进制转换:
- 单精度浮点数与十六进制之间的转换。
- 双精度浮点数与十六进制之间的转换。
- C语言实现:
- 使用指针法、共用体法和memcpy()函数法实现浮点数与十六进制之间的转换。
使用方法
- 下载资源文件:
- 下载本仓库中的资源文件,包含详细的代码示例和解释。
- 阅读教程:
- 参考资源文件中的代码示例,理解如何在C语言中实现浮点数与十六进制之间的转换。
- 实践应用:
- 将所学知识应用到实际项目中,特别是在需要进行数据传输和处理的场景中。
注意事项
- 本教程适用于有一定C语言基础的开发者。
- 在实际应用中,请根据具体需求选择合适的转换方法。
贡献
欢迎对本资源文件进行改进和补充,如果您有任何建议或发现错误,请提交Issue或Pull Request。
许可证
本资源文件遵循MIT许可证,详情请参阅LICENSE文件。